This remote and dramatic region of India is distinctive in its moon-like high altitude desert landscapes. Leh and the surrounding countryside are dotted with dozens of Buddhist monasteries perched precarious-like on mountain ridges and despite the sometimes weather beaten environment the Ladakhi people are possibly the warmest in their welcome anywhere in India.

This morning enjoy a half day guided tour of Leh, visiting the crumbling Palace which resembles the Potala Palace of Lhasa with its Tibetan influences. Continue on to visit the Tsemo Gompa with its 2 storey high Maitreya, and the Shanti Stupa built by Japanese Buddhists. Afternoon free to explore Leh town and Old Village, with its maze of narrow lanes. (Breakfast).
Today visit the gompas at Hemis, Shey (which was also the summer palace of the Ladakhi royalty) and Thiksey. It is worth getting up extra early in order to visit Thiksey in time for the morning puja which starts at 7am, when the monks blow their enormous Tibetan horns. All the gompas have beautifully painted murals and art works. Hemis is one of the most famous and most visited in Ladakh, thanks mainly to the colourful three day festival held in June each year with the ceremonial mask dances. This morning drive towards Likir, which is around 65kms from Leh. Here visit the impressive Likir gompa which is about an hour's walk from the village. Continue by foot on your 1 night/2 day trek - the trek is a relatively easy trek, with no major ascents or descents. Today's walk will take you over a couple of passes, Pobe La (3550m) and Charatse La (3650m), passing through some pretty villages and ending the day at Yangtang, which has stunning views overlooking the Zanskar Range. Overnight in a local guesthouse. (Half Board)
After breakfast continue by foot towards Rizong - the path follows a stream and orchards of apple and apricot trees. Passing a small nunnery and then continuing through a narrow gorge, you'll reach the magnificent gompa at Rizong, which is home to 30 or so monks, who are part of the Gelupka order, known to be the most austere of all the orders. After lunch you'll be met by your driver and drive to Alchi. Stay 1 night in the village where there are as many chortens (stone structures containing relics) as houses. Stay 1 night at Alchi Resort. Have the morning to explore the religious enclave in this village, which dates back to the 11th Century, and comprises of fine examples of early Buddhist art in the Kashmiri tradition, which is quite different to the typical Tibetan style of most gompas in Ladakh. Continue after lunch back to Leh - you can stop off en route at Phyang gompa, which belongs to the Kagyupa (red hat) order. Overnight in Leh ay the Hotel Omasila. (Breakfast).
Depart for the Nubra Valley today, passing over Khardung La Pass, often claimed to be the highest navigable road in the world at 5600m. The Nubra Valley is an outstanding area to visit, and an area which few visitors venture to. Staying 2 nights in the village of Hunder, one of those rare places on earth where you can see in one place the splendid beauty of a desert with two humped camels, sand dunes, rolling mountains and snow peaks.
